The mix of tile and metal roofing around Bilambil Heights means problems can vary street to street. Older tile roofs often cop cracked tiles, worn bedding, and tired pointing; metal roofs can show early signs of fastener wear, corrosion, and leaks around flashings—especially after years of summer heat expansion and winter rain cycles. Add leaf litter from nearby trees and you’ve got gutters and valleys that can clog fast, pushing water where it shouldn’t go.

What’s the difference between a roof repair and a roof restoration?
A roof repair targets a specific fault—like a leaking valley, broken tiles, or a flashing that’s lifting. A roof restoration is broader: clean the roof, fix defects, improve water-shedding details, then seal/coat or repaint (where suitable) to extend roof life and lift presentation.
Will roof painting stop a leak?
Not on its own. Roof painting is a protective finish, not a waterproof band-aid. If water is getting in via ridge caps, penetrations, valleys, or failed flashings, those issues need to be repaired first—then coatings go on once the roof is sound.

How long does roofing work usually take in Bilambil Heights?
It depends on roof size, pitch, access, and what’s required. A targeted leak repair can be relatively quick, while a full restoration (clean, repair, prep, coat) takes longer due to proper preparation and curing times—especially important in humid or showery weather.
Can you work around wet weather?
We plan around the forecast as much as possible. Some steps (like coatings and certain compounds) need dry conditions and the right cure time. If weather turns, we’ll prioritise making the roof safe and watertight, then return to finish the restoration stages properly.
